Sandra Irene Sepsey-Whiteley (Hancock)

September 1, 1944 - February 8, 2026
Sandra Irene Sepsey-Whiteley (Hancock)

Sandy passed away at home in Fallon, Nevada, after a 9-year-long battle with small-cell lung cancer. She was 81. 

Sandy was a beacon of light, joy, and love for her family and everyone who knew her. She was born in Springfield, Illinois, to parents Robert and Avo Hancock. As a child, she spent time in Germany, where her father, a US Army Air Corps captain, participated in the Berlin Airlift Operations. 

When her father was assigned to March Air Force Base (AFB), the family settled in Riverside, California, where she grew up and attended local schools. She graduated from Riverside Poly High School in 1962. Shortly thereafter, she began a family with her then-husband, Walter McAlister. They had three children, Kristine, Robert, and Karen. 

Later, Sandy became a single mother raising her family alone until she remarried Franklyn Sepsey in 1988. 

Sandy was a strong, independent woman. After moving to Independence, California, she worked in local stores until she was offered a job with the county’s school bookmobile library. Demonstrating a strong work ethic, she was offered a trainee position at the Inyo County Auditor's Office. She excelled, advancing to management positions over the next 27 years until she retired with 30 years of service in 1997. Her husband, Franklyn Sepsey, passed away in 2001. 

In 2005, she met Larry Whiteley on a dating app, found they had many common interests, and grew up just 10 miles apart. They were an instant love match, and she moved to Fallon, Nevada, shortly thereafter. They married in 2013 and both considered each other the best thing they ever found on the internet.  

A loving, caring person, she was deeply devoted to her family and often expressed her love for her husband and family members. While in Fallon, she was a volunteer at the Banner Churchill Hospital Auxiliary for 13 years, logging 4,000 volunteer hours.
